Allie Ryans and James Graham have unexpectedly become friends. And there's no denying that the two have some serious chemistry between them. After Allie unintentionally makes James jealous, he decides to go out and do the one thing he knows he's good at. Picking up girls. After a regretful night occurs, James realizes what he's done and what it'll do to his near perfect relationship with Allie. As news of his night gets out, Allie is immediately heartbroken. James must prove to not only Allie, but himself that he's worth the pain he's caused her as the consequences of his actions unravel from that night. Will she forgive him and move on with him, or does he have to live with his mistake for the rest of his life?
